Ghost in the Shell
Ghost in the Shell [Movie] Peter the Great gave it a 8.
In the year 2029, the barriers of our world have been broken down by the net and by cybernetics, but this brings new vulnerability to humans in the form of brain-hacking. When a highly-wanted hacker known as 'The Puppetmaster' begins involving them in politics, Section 9, a group of cybernetically enhanced cops, are called in to investigate and stop the Puppetmaster.

Speed Racer
Speed Racer [TV] Peter the Great gave it a 5.
Originally titled "Mach Go Go Go", the series was soon brought over to the United States and subbed into English as "Speed Racer". It follows the adventures of a race car driver named Speed Racer, his girlfriend/spotter Trixie, his pit mechanic Sparky, his dad Pop, his mom Mom, his younger brother Spritle, and his pet monkey Chim-Chim.

Samurai Pizza Cats
Samurai Pizza Cats [TV] Peter the Great gave it a 3.
the eponymous Cats are the owners/employees of a pizza parlor, who defend their city and the royal family (pushy, spoiled Princess Violet [Usa-Hime], and her demented father, Emperor Fred [Shogun Tokugawa Iei-Iei]) from the machinations of the villainous fox the Big Cheese (Ko'on-no-Kami). Between the giant robots, the Ninja Crows and the, um, peculiarities of their emperor, this is both harder than it sounds and easier than it ought to be.
